Shifting From Casual to Corporate: Building a Business-Ready Wardrobe
Navigating the transition from casual attire to corporate dress can feel like an daunting task. professional dress code It's essential to curate a wardrobe that projects professionalism while adhering to office expectations. Begin by acquiring foundational pieces like tailored blazers, crisp shirts, and well-fitting trousers. Choose classic colors such as black, navy, gray, and white for a base, then add pops of color through accessories or statement pieces. Remember, it's about striking an balance between style and appropriateness.
- Think about your workplace culture to understand the appropriate level of formality.
- Emphasize quality over number. Well-made garments will last longer and look more sophisticated.
- Complement your outfits with tasteful jewelry, a watch, or a scarf to add a individual touch.
By following these tips, you can develop a business-ready wardrobe that makes your feel confident and prepared to prosper in the corporate world.

Business Dress for Every Occasion: A Comprehensive Guide
Navigating the world of professional attire can be tricky, especially when faced with various occasions. From corporate meetings to networking events, understanding the appropriate dress code is crucial for making a good impression. This comprehensive guide will help you decode professional attire for every occasion, ensuring you always look and feel your best.
- Commence with the basics: A well-fitted suit in a neutral shade is a versatile choice for formal settings. Pair it with a crisp shirt or blouse and classic shoes.
- Think about the industry: Creative fields may allow for more casual dress codes, while finance or law tend to be more formal.
- Complement your outfit with understated jewelry and a professional handbag.
